The best AI note-taking apps compared
| App | Best for | Free | Paid from |
|---|---|---|---|
| Otter | Live transcription | Yes | ~$17/mo |
| Fathom | Best free (unlimited) | Yes | ~$15/mo |
| Granola | Bot-free, tidy notes | Trial | ~$14/mo |
| Fireflies | Sales & CRM sync | Yes | ~$10/mo |
| Jamie | Private, accurate, bot-free | Yes | ~$24/mo |
| Notion AI | Notes inside your workspace | Yes | ~$10/mo |
| NotebookLM | Research & synthesis | Free | Free |
1. Otter — best for live transcription
Otter transcribes Zoom, Meet, and Teams in real time, with summaries, action items, and searchable archives. The reliable default for anyone who needs an accurate record of every call.
Best for: live transcription and archives. Price: free (300 min/mo); Pro ~$17/mo. Read our Otter review
2. Fathom — best free note-taker
Fathom offers unlimited recording and transcription on its free plan, with fast summaries often ready before the call ends. The best pick if you don’t want to pay at all.
Best for: free unlimited notes. Price: free; advanced AI from ~$15/mo.
3. Granola — best bot-free notes
Granola enhances the notes you type instead of sending a visible bot into the call, capturing audio quietly on your device. Clean, private, and great for back-to-back days.
Best for: tidy notes without a bot. Price: free (limited history); from ~$14/mo.
4. Fireflies — best for sales & CRM
Fireflies records, transcribes, and pushes insights into your CRM, with a searchable archive and Slack assistant. The pick for revenue teams that live in follow-ups.
Best for: sales and CRM workflows. Price: free tier; paid from ~$10/mo.
5. Jamie — best private & accurate
Jamie is bot-free, EU-hosted, and strong on speaker identification and accuracy — it even remembers voices across meetings. Ideal for confidential, client-facing calls.
Best for: confidential meetings. Price: free (10 meetings/mo); paid from ~$24/mo.
6. Notion AI — best inside your workspace
If your team already runs on Notion, its AI cleans up and organizes notes right where your docs and projects live — no separate app to manage.
Best for: Notion teams. Price: free plan; AI ~$10/mo. Notion AI review
7. NotebookLM — best for research
Google’s NotebookLM isn’t a meeting bot; it turns your notes, transcripts, and documents into summaries, Q&A, and audio overviews. Great for synthesizing after the meeting. It’s free.
Best for: post-meeting synthesis. Price: free.

Bot or bot-free? The main 2026 choice
Tools like Otter and Fireflies join as a visible participant, which is fine internally but can kill candor on client or sales calls. Granola, Jamie, and Fathom’s desktop mode capture audio quietly instead. If your meetings are sensitive, go bot-free; if you want the fullest record and integrations, a bot tool is fine.

FAQ
What is the best AI note-taking app? Otter for live transcription, Fathom for a free unlimited option, and Granola or Jamie if you want private, bot-free notes.
What’s the best free AI note-taker? Fathom offers unlimited free recording and transcription, and Otter, Fireflies, and Jamie all have capable free tiers.
Are AI meeting notes accurate? Modern tools transcribe and summarize well, but always review key decisions and action items before acting on them.
What is a bot-free note-taker? One that captures audio on your device instead of sending a visible bot into the call — Granola, Jamie, and Fathom’s desktop mode work this way, which suits private meetings.
Which AI note-taker is best for sales? Fireflies, because it syncs meeting insights straight into your CRM and flags follow-ups.
Can AI note-takers join Zoom, Meet, and Teams? Yes — the major apps work across Zoom, Google Meet, and Microsoft Teams, and several also capture in-person meetings.
